Giannis Antetokounmpo Fires Back At Stephen A. Smith For Trash-talking His Legacy

So if you missed it, Giannis Antetokounmpo recently clapped back at Stephen A. Smith for talking smack about his legacy. The Greek Freak wasn’t having any of it and decided to set the record straight. And let me tell you, it was epic!

Giannis wasn’t ready to sit and watch Smith drag him hence hitting back!

During a recent segment addressing rumors surrounding Antetokounmpo’s future with the Milwaukee Bucks, Smith didn’t hold back. While acknowledging Giannis’ accolades, Smith claimed that the Greek superstar would be considered an “underachiever” if he fails to win another NBA championship. He pointed to the Bucks’ lack of postseason success since their 2021 title, highlighting the fact that they haven’t advanced past the first round since then—something Smith bluntly called “unacceptable.”

In a post to his Instagram Story on Sunday, the two-time MVP shared a fan’s message defending him. The post read, “Giannis went from selling sunglasses on a beach in Greece to a multi-millionaire who won a championship without having to run to a superteam. He has over-achieved his wildest dreams and anyone who thinks otherwise is ridiculous.” Giannis added a pair of “?” emojis and a fire emoji to the post, making it clear where he stood on the matter.

Antetokounmpo, still just 30 years old, has one of the most compelling and decorated resumes in modern basketball. He’s a nine-time All-Star, two-time NBA MVP, NBA champion, Finals MVP, and former Defensive Player of the Year.

More importantly, he led the Bucks to their first title in 50 years without forming or joining a superteam—something many fans view as a rare feat in today’s NBA landscape.

Smith’s claim struck a nerve not just with Antetokounmpo, but with basketball fans and analysts who view Giannis’ rise as one of the sport’s most inspiring stories.

Born into poverty in Athens, Greece, Antetokounmpo and his brothers often went without food and basic necessities. His journey from hustling sunglasses on the street to becoming the face of an NBA franchise—and ultimately, a world champion—is nothing short of extraordinary.
